Default Installing Drip Edge

Hi: I have a 2003 Disco II. I'm trying to install some of the OEM black drip edge that runs along the left-hand side of my roof and wraps around a couple inches around the back corner to the tailgate. Does anyone know how to snap it in place.? I can't figure if I'm supposed to position the top first and then push in the bottom or position the bottom first and snap it in at the tope. Any advice appreciated!!!

Default Drip Edge

Just did mine last week.

Top down.

Begin with the rear and slide in under the corner that goes up. Then work your way to the front of the vehicle. The back corner is the hardest part to snap on but once you get it the long section is easy.
